About Commonwealth Healthcare Corporation — Intensive Outpatient Treatment
Commonwealth Healthcare Corporation, located in Saipan, MP, provides a wide array of rehabilitation services designed for adults and young adults facing challenges related to substance use and concurrent mental health issues. The center offers several treatment options, including intensive outpatient programs, outpatient services, and regular outpatient care. These programs are structured to deliver personalized care, employing evidence-based methods such as 12-step facilitation, anger management, and brief interventions. Additionally, the facility is committed to serving distinct populations, including active duty military personnel as well as adult men and women. With an emphasis on high-quality care and customized treatment plans, Commonwealth Healthcare Corporation is devoted to supporting individuals on their journey toward lasting recovery.

Intensive outpatient programs (IOP) generally meet 9 to 12 hours per week, often scheduled in the mornings or evenings to accommodate work or school. Sessions include group therapy, individual counseling, and skill-building workshops. Contact the center to discuss scheduling options.
Young adult tracks address the unique challenges of this age group, including peer pressure, identity formation, and transitioning to independence. These programs often include career counseling and life skills development alongside traditional addiction therapy.

Continuing care planning begins before discharge and may include step-down to outpatient services, referrals to sober living homes, alumni group meetings, and connections to community recovery resources. Many facilities maintain alumni networks that provide ongoing peer support and accountability.
